March 3, 2005 -- Complaint filed against Scott Bloch by an anonymous employee and three whistleblower protection groups
Oct. 19, 2005 -- OPM IG investigates charges that Bloch improperly retaliated against employeesMay 23, 2007 - OSC determines that General Services Administration chief Lurita Doan violated Hatch ActJuly 13, 2007 -- Congress grills Bloch on his Hatch Act investigation and use of personal e-mail to discuss agency mattersOct 10, 2007 - Watchdogs say OSC should not receive funding until investigation of Bloch is concludedNov. 28, 2007 - Wall Street Journal reports Bloch hired service to wipe clean several OSC computers, including his ownMay 6, 2008 - FBI raids OSC offices and Bloch's home, seizing computers and filesAug. 29, 2008 - OSC spokesman and acting chief of staff fired by BlochOct. 23, 2008 - White House asks Bloch to resign.
